WebbIt's important to keep your super guarantee (SG) obligations in check. Forgetting obligations, like paying SG for your workers, can end up being very costly for your business. Make sure you meet the quarterly SG due dates are and pay at the correct SG rate. The current SG rate is 10.5%, but this will increase to 11% on 1 July.

WebbEmployer obligations As an employer, you must report employee earnings to the ATO, and meet financial and other requirements including maintaining a safe workplace. Employing staff means meeting a number of legal obligations. Before employing staff, you need understand the following areas.
